KEMMERER JUNIOR SENIOR HIGH SCHOOL
Kemmerer Junior Senior High School is a Title I public high school that is part of the Lincoln County School District #1 school district, located in Kemmerer, WY with about 248 students offering grade levels from 7th Grade to 12th Grade. A Title I school provides supplemental financial assistance to school districts for children from low-income families. Its purpose is to provide all children significant opportunity to receive a fair, equitable, and high-quality education. With about 18 teachers, Kemmerer Junior Senior High School has a student/teacher ratio of about 13:1. The national average for public schools is about 15:1. A lower student/teacher ratio is a key factor that determines how much a teacher can devote his/her time to each individual student thus improving, or reducing (in the event of a higher student/teacher ratio) the attention each student is given for their educational needs.
Kemmerer Junior-Senior High School, located in Kemmerer, Wyoming, serves as the primary secondary education hub for the Lincoln County School District #1. As a combined junior and senior high facility, the school provides a continuous academic environment for students in grades 7 through 12. The school is deeply rooted in the local community—often recognized as the home of the "Rangers"—and emphasizes a commitment to fostering both academic achievement and personal growth within a smaller, tight-knit educational setting typical of Wyoming’s rural districts.
The institution focuses on preparing students for post-secondary success by offering a curriculum that balances core academic requirements with extracurricular opportunities, including athletics and various student organizations. By utilizing the resources of the Lincoln County School District, the school strives to maintain high standards while catering to the unique needs of students in the Fossil Basin area.
